Ityhubhu yethu yeSapphire/Quartz Resistance High Temperature yenzelwe ukumelana nobushushu obugqithisileyo kunye neemeko ezinzima, nto leyo eyenza ukuba ifaneleke ukusetyenziswa kwimizi-mveliso. Yenziwe ngezinto zesapphire kunye nequartz ezikumgangatho ophezulu, le tyhubhu inika ukuqina okugqwesileyo kunye nozinzo lobushushu.
Icandelo lesafire linika ubulukhuni obungenakuthelekiswa nanto kunye nokumelana nokukrala, okuqinisekisa ukusebenza okuhlala ixesha elide kwiindawo ezirhabaxa. Okwangoku, inxalenye yequartz inika ukumelana nokutsha kobushushu kunye nokucaca kokukhanya, okwenza ukuba ifaneleke ukujongwa ngokuchanekileyo.
Le tube iyakwazi ukumelana namaqondo obushushu aphezulu kwaye imelane nokugqwala kweekhemikhali, nto leyo eyenza ukuba ifaneleke ukusetyenziswa kwiinkqubo ezahlukeneyo zoshishino, kuquka ii-oven ezishushu kakhulu, ii-chemical reactors, kunye nokuveliswa kwee-semiconductor.
